Shape the Future of Clean Energy and National Security

At Cavendish Nuclear we’re working to create a safe and secure world, together, and if you join us, you can play your part as an Engineering Manager at our Warrington, Cheshire site.

The role

As an Engineering Manager, you’ll have a role that is out of the ordinary. You’ll lead a multi-disciplinary engineering team to deliver technical solutions across complex projects from concept design through to full Engineering, Procurement and Construction (EPC). You’ll play a pivotal role in ensuring projects meet budget and performance targets, while acting as a Technical or Design Authority to provide assurance across a range of assets.

Day-to-day, you will

  • Lead and manage engineering teams to deliver project scope effectively.
  • Oversee technical solutions and ensure compliance with safety and quality standards.
  • Act as Technical/Design Authority, providing assurance and governance.
  • Integrate multi-disciplinary tasks and work packages across the project lifecycle.
  • Support estimating and planning for engineering scope from concept to completion.

This is a permanent role, working 37 hours per week, based at Warrington, Cheshire, with at least three days onsite per week.

Essential experience of the Engineering Manager:
  • Proven experience managing engineering scope and leading teams.
  • Strong background in project delivery across the full lifecycle, with an understanding of multi-disciplinary interfaces.
Qualifications for the Engineering Manager:
  • Degree (or equivalent) in a relevant engineering discipline or chartered status, with significant demonstrable experience.

As a leader within the UK nuclear industry, Cavendish Nuclear, part of Babcock International Group, provides a comprehensive range of critical nuclear solutions in clean energy, defence and civil new build and decommissioning projects. Together, we’re innovating to make nuclear safer, faster and cost-effective across the nuclear energy life cycle. Your career with us could take you anywhere within Babcock International Group – from Canada, the USA to Japan. Work with us to create a safe and secure world, together.
